    Regaining the Shore Agency of Maracaibo. Coastal Waste Narratives

    Get PDF
    Maracaibo has lived from its territory, particularly the Maracaibo Lake. Throughout the years the lake has been exploited for its oil, resulting in a clear degradation. If design can serve as a narrative by interpreting the traces of the space, how can we read this broken space from the perception of its inhabitants? Understanding the notion of the area’s vulnerability, how can we acknowledge and have preferable measures for recognition and respectful use of the shore? The research is based on the concepts of spatial justice, community participation and empowerment to accomplish the regaining of this coastal space. It was observed through a historical and geographical analysis that the city has had little concern in integrating the coast to its planning, causing a fragmented space, and looks on the reasons and consequences this has had. This research develops a proposal through the selection of a case study community, Lago y Sol. This is made recollecting the community’s insight and narratives through participation methods like workshops and interviews. The data compiled served as a base to develop the design that aims to create a place for them to enjoy while addressing the issue of coastal waste. The intent is to present an example of how the natural and the built environment can bridge for a better urban development based on the imaginary of its direct users.     Hydrogen-Bonding Organocatalysis Enabled Photocatalytic Intramolecular [2+2]-Cycloaddition Reaction

    Get PDF
    The combination of organocatalytic activation and photocatalysis for enabling the intramolecular [2+2]‐cycloaddition of enone‐ene substrates bearing one Lewis base binding site is reported. While in a variety of solvents a poor conversion or no reaction takes place in the absence of a hydrogen bonding catalyst, the corresponding ring‐fused cyclobutane products could be built in moderate to good yields using a synergistic dual iridium‐urea co‐catalytic system. Control and mechanistic studies supported the postulated interaction between the organocatalyst and the substrate, which proved essential for an efficient energy transfer from the photosensitizer

    The Socio-Educational Adaptation of Secondary School Migrant Students in Sicily: Migrant Generation, School Linguistic Mediation and Teacher Proactivity Factors

    Get PDF
    This study aims to analyze the implications of linguistic mediation processes and educational proactivity in schools for the socio-educational adaptation of immigrant students. The study is based on empirical research and the perspectives of the main actors: the immigrant students themselves. To this end, a non-experimental and descriptive quantitative methodology was used. The sample consisted of 100 students of foreign origin enrolled in an Italian school located in a typical socio-cultural environment. The results show significant differences in linguistic mediation and socio-educational variables and differences in expectations of progress and social adaptation of students born outside Italy vis-a-vis students who, although born in Italy, are still considered foreigners.     Experimental Analysis of the Reaction Rate of Hydrated Class G Cement Powder at 11 bar PCO2 and Ambient Temperature

    Get PDF
    The aim of this work is to study the alteration of class G Cement at ambient temperature under a relatively high CO2 partial pressure through suitably designed laboratory experiments, in which cement hydration and carbonation are taken into account separately. First, the hydration process was carried out for 28 days to identify and quantify the hydrated solid phases formed. After the completion of hydration, accompanied by partial carbonation under atmospheric conditions, the carbonation process was investigated using a stirred micro-reactor by reacting cement powder with pure CO2(g) (PCO2 = 11 bar) and MilliQ water for different reaction times. The reaction time was varied to constrain the reaction kinetics of the carbonation process and to investigate the evolution of primary and secondary solid phases. Mineralogical analyses (X-ray Powder Diffraction and Scanning Electron Microscope) were carried out to this purpose. Water analyses were also performed by ion chromatography at the end of each experimental run to investigate the chemical effects of cement carbonation on the aqueous solution. The carbonation degree was calculated from the results of Thermo-Gravimetric analysis (TGA). The main results of these experiments is the quick conversion of portlandite and Ca1.60SiO3.6·2.58H2O (C-S-H) to calcite. In fact, the carbonation degree attains 80% after 6 hours of reaction time.     Ecological risk assessment of organic waste amendments using the species sensitivity distribution from a soil organisms test battery

    Get PDF
    Safe amendment rates (the predicted no-effect concentration or PNEC) of seven organic wastes were estimated from the species sensitivity distribution of a battery of soil biota tests and compared with different realistic amendment scenarios (different predicted environmental concentrations or PEC). None of the wastes was expected to exert noxious effects on soil biota if applied according either to the usual maximum amendment rates in Europe or phosphorus demands of crops (below 2 tonnes DM ha−1). However, some of the wastes might be problematic if applied according to nitrogen demands of crops (above 2 tonnes DM ha−1). Ammonium content and organic matter stability of the studied wastes are the most influential determinants of the maximum amendment rates derived in this study, but not pollutant burden. This finding indicates the need to stabilize wastes prior to their reuse in soils in order to avoid short-term impacts on soil communities
